The Representational Challenge for Designing and Managing 5P Medicine Ecosystems
Bernd Blobel1,2,3,4, Frank Oemig5,6, Pekka Ruotsalainen7
1University of Regensburg, Medical Faculty, Regensburg, Germany.
The global health sector is shifting to personalized medicine, leveraging advanced technologies. A standardized architecture (ISO 23903) is proposed to manage complex health ecosystems and ensure interoperability for better data integration.
Area of Science:
- Health Informatics
- Systems Engineering
- Precision Medicine
Background:
- Global health systems are transforming towards personalized, preventive, predictive, and participative precision medicine (5PM).
- This transformation is driven by advanced technologies like AI, micro/nanotechnologies, and edge computing.
- Effective integration requires understanding complex health ecosystems from individual data to universal context.
Purpose of the Study:
- To address the challenge of consistent and formalized representation of transformed health ecosystems.
- To enable communication and cooperation among diverse domain actors.
- To advance the design and management of dynamic health ecosystems from data to knowledge.
Main Methods:
- Developing a system-oriented, architecture-centric, ontology-based, policy-driven approach.
- Utilizing ISO/IEC 21838 Top Level Ontologies for interrelating business views of the ecosystem.
- Transforming outcomes into implementable solutions via ISO/IEC 10746 Open Distributed Processing Reference Model.
Main Results:
- A model and framework for managing complex health ecosystems have been developed.
- This approach ensures consistent and formalized representation across diverse domains.
- Standardization as ISO 23903 provides an Interoperability and Integration Reference Architecture.
Conclusions:
- The developed ISO 23903 standard provides a robust framework for health ecosystem interoperability.
- This architecture facilitates the integration of diverse data and methodologies in precision medicine.
- The approach enables effective management and advancement of health and social care systems.
